Humic Acid Market Definition
Humic acid refers to a class of natural organic compounds formed through the biodegradation of plant and animal matter, commonly found in soil, peat, and lignite deposits. It is a key component of humic substances and serves as a soil conditioner, chelating agent, and microbial stimulator. Owing to its ability to improve nutrient absorption, soil fertility, and crop productivity, humic acid finds broad applications in agriculture, horticulture, animal feed, pharmaceuticals, and environmental remediation.

Humic Acid Market Dynamics
1. Market Drivers
-
Shift Toward Organic Fertilizers:
The growing awareness of the harmful environmental and health impacts of chemical fertilizers has accelerated the adoption of humic acid as a natural alternative. Farmers are increasingly switching to bio-based soil enhancers to improve yield and maintain soil structure. -
Rising Agricultural Productivity Demand:
With the global population projected to exceed 9.7 billion by 2050, the pressure on agricultural productivity continues to mount. Humic acid boosts nutrient uptake and enhances soil water retention, supporting higher yields without increasing chemical input. -
Government Support for Sustainable Farming:
Multiple countries are investing in organic farming initiatives and offering subsidies for the use of bio-fertilizers. For instance, the European Green Deal and India’s National Mission on Sustainable Agriculture (NMSA) are promoting humic acid utilization to reduce dependency on synthetic fertilizers. -
Health and Environmental Benefits:
Humic acid reduces nitrate leaching, enhances carbon sequestration, and minimizes soil erosion — all of which contribute to environmental sustainability. Additionally, its use in dietary supplements supports detoxification and nutrient absorption in humans and livestock.
2. Market Restraints
-
Lack of Standardization:
The absence of globally accepted testing and quality standards for humic acid content has created challenges for manufacturers and regulators, affecting international trade consistency. -
Limited Awareness in Developing Nations:
In emerging economies, farmers often remain unaware of the long-term benefits of humic acid, preferring cheaper synthetic fertilizers due to immediate visible results.

Humic Acid Market Segment Analysis
By Form
-
Powdered: Widely used in large-scale agricultural applications due to ease of mixing with soil and fertilizers.
-
Granular: Preferred for precision farming and slow nutrient release.
-
Liquid: Fast-growing segment owing to the rise of drip irrigation systems and foliar spray methods for efficient nutrient delivery.
By Grade
-
Technical Grade: Dominates the market as it is used extensively in agriculture and soil conditioning.
-
Food Grade & Biotech Grade: Expected to witness rapid growth, driven by applications in dietary supplements and pharmaceuticals.
By Distribution Channel
-
Offline: Includes direct sales, distributors, and agricultural supply stores — still the primary channel in developing nations.
-
Online: Rapidly emerging due to e-commerce platforms and digital agri-solutions offering global accessibility.
By Application
-
Agriculture: Largest segment, driven by demand for enhanced soil fertility and organic farming practices.
-
Animal Feed: Improves gut health and nutrient absorption in livestock.
-
Pharmaceuticals & Dietary Supplements: Used for detoxification and as an antioxidant.
-
Horticulture & Gardening: Increasing use in lawns, nurseries, and greenhouse applications.
-
Others: Includes water purification and ecological bioremediation.
Regional Insights
Europe
Europe held a major share in 2024 and is expected to continue leading through 2032, supported by stringent environmental policies and strong consumer preference for organic products. The region imported 3.3 million tons of organic agricultural products in 2023, underscoring a significant market for humic acid-based inputs.
Asia Pacific
Asia Pacific is projected to witness the fastest CAGR, driven by growing population, declining arable land, and government-backed sustainable agriculture programs in India, China, and Australia. The Indian organic farming movement and the expansion of bio-fertilizer producers are propelling regional growth.
North America
The U.S. market benefits from the adoption of precision farming technologies and the increasing popularity of eco-friendly fertilizers. Rising health awareness has also boosted demand for humic acid-based dietary supplements.
South America
Countries such as Brazil and Argentina are focusing on improving soil fertility for soybean and corn cultivation, generating significant opportunities for humic acid suppliers.
Middle East & Africa
Steady growth is expected as nations like South Africa and GCC countries shift toward sustainable soil management to combat desertification and water scarcity.
